- [ ] Step 7: Archive cold storage buckets (Glacierline tier). Confirm both ceremony witnesses are present, verify bucket manifests match the Oxbow ledger, then seal the archive key shares. Plugin authors may observe but not handle shares. Once sealed, the archive index itself is encrypted and can only be reopened with the passphrase below.

vault phrase of badup-hahig = tamael-aldael-kelmir-istael-fenok-istwyn-tamius-jorath-oliion

# Nightly reminder job for the Tallow Creek Clinic scheduler.
# Runs at 06:00 local; pulls tomorrow's appointments and queues SMS.
# REMINDER_WINDOW_HOURS and CLINIC_TZ must match the scheduler config.
# Do not enable DRY_RUN in prod. The SMS gateway credential for the
# Pellerman relay is required and belongs on the line below:

sealed setting: ARCHIVE_KEY3=8d0

## Formula sandbox tuning

User-supplied formulas in Gridmoor execute inside a restricted interpreter with hard ceilings on time, memory, and call depth. Reviewers should confirm any change to these ceilings is justified in the PR description, since raising them widens the abuse surface. Defaults were chosen from production traces. The current limits are as follows.

limits module of tafog-fawip:
WEIGHTS = {
    "julix": 57,
    "lamys": 992,
    "kasvan": 209,
    "quenok": 750,
    "alddor": 259,
    "oliath": 1009,
    "wenix": 815,
}

### Runbook: ReceiptRelay mailer stuck

Symptoms: donation receipts queueing, no sends, queue depth alert fires.

First: check the SMTP relay health endpoint. If healthy, the mailer worker is probably wedged on a malformed template — restart the worker pool, not the whole service. If unhealthy, fail over to the secondary relay and page the infra rotation. Do not replay the dead-letter queue until dedupe is confirmed on, or donors get duplicate receipts. Verify the service is running with the following configuration values.

config for kajeg-bafop:
[julael]
host = julael.plorvadata.corp
user = julael_svc
database = julael_prod